Ways to Save Money

There are a number of ways to save water, and they all start with you .

  1. Check your water meter and bill to track your water usage.
  2. Install covers on pools and spas and check for leaks around the pumps.
  3. Use garbage disposal sparingly.   Compost instead and save gallons everytime.
  4. Plant during the spring or fall when water requirements are lower.
  5. Minimize evaporation by watering during the early morning hours when temperatures are cooler and winds are lighter.
  6. Time your shower to keep it under 5 minutes.  You'll save up to 1000 gallons a month.
  7. Turn off the water while you brush your teeth and save 4 gallons a minute.  That's 200 gallons a week for a family of four.
  8. Make sure the toilet flapper doesn't stick open after flushing.
  9. Make sure you know where your master water shut off valve is located.  This could save gallons of water and damage to your home if a pipe were to burst.

  Do one thing each day that will save water.
